Why Online Privacy Matters
Every time someone creates an account, uploads a photo, or shares personal details, they leave a digital footprint. This information can sometimes be collected, stored, or misused if proper precautions are not taken. Protecting personal data helps reduce the risk of identity theft, scams, and unauthorized sharing of private information.
Common Online Risks
The internet contains many useful resources, but it also presents challenges. Phishing emails, fake websites, weak passwords, and oversharing on social media can expose personal information. Understanding these risks helps users make smarter decisions while browsing online.
Building Strong Security Habits
A few simple habits can greatly improve online safety. Using strong and unique passwords for every account is an important first step. Enabling two-factor authentication adds another layer of protection. Keeping devices and software updated also helps prevent security vulnerabilities from being exploited.
Think Before You Share
Photos, videos, and personal updates can spread quickly online. Before posting, it is worth considering who will see the content and whether it could affect privacy in the future. Adjusting privacy settings and limiting the amount of personal information shared publicly are effective ways to stay protected.
Recognizing Reliable Information
Not everything found online is accurate. Users should evaluate information carefully by checking whether it comes from trustworthy and reputable sources. Developing critical thinking skills helps avoid misinformation and improves the overall online experience.
Respecting Digital Privacy
Online privacy is not only about protecting yourself but also about respecting others. Sharing someone else’s personal information or images without their permission can cause harm and violate their privacy. Responsible digital behavior helps create a safer internet for everyone.
